Defining Vacuum Pouches
Vacuum pouches are multi-layered plastic packaging designed to remove air before sealing. Once sealed, the product remains in reduced-oxygen conditions, which slows down spoilage and maintains quality.
Their construction plays an important role. They use layered film technology to create a strong barrier against air and moisture, which limits bacteria development and retain freshness.
This makes them especially useful for perishable goods, where product condition is critical.
How Vacuum Pouches Work
The process is direct and effective:
- Insert the item into the pouch
- Position the open end in a sealing machine
- Air is extracted
- The bag is sealed securely
This reduces contact with oxygen, which is one of the main causes of spoilage. The result is a secure, compact package that protects both the contents and their quality during handling and distribution.
Reasons for Using Vacuum Pouches
These pouches address multiple packaging issues. Their role goes beyond simple containment.
Longer Shelf Life
Air removal reduces bacterial and mould growth. This helps products stay fresh for longer and reduces the need for preservatives.
Freezer Burn Prevention
Vacuum sealing prevents moisture loss in frozen products, helping retain texture and flavour when the product is thawed.
Waste Reduction
Longer shelf life means fewer products are discarded. This supports better cost management and more efficient inventory control.
Strong and Reliable Packaging
They are built for strength and durability. Their consistent thickness and seal strength make them suitable for demanding environments.
Typical Applications
Vacuum pouches are used across a wide range of industries. Their flexibility allows them to handle different product types.
Food Industry Use
Typical applications include:
- Fresh meat and poultry
- Seafood products
- Cheese and dairy products
- Vegetables and prepared meals
Each application benefits from controlled storage conditions and improved freshness.
Retail and Distribution
Retailers use vacuum pouches to extend shelf life and improve product presentation, especially for chilled and frozen goods.
Non-Food Applications
Outside food sectors, they are used for:
- Healthcare materials
- Pharmaceutical products
- Sensitive components requiring protection from air and moisture
This shows their usefulness in settings requiring strict protection.
Choosing the Right Vacuum Pouch
Options vary depending on requirements. Choice depends on the item and how it will be stored or transported.
Film Composition
Multi-layer films provide better protection, helping preserve internal environments.
Thickness and Strength
Robust items need thicker materials to prevent punctures.
Correct Sizing
A well-fitted pouch improves sealing performance and minimises excess packaging.
Specific Needs
Some products need specific features, such as enhanced protection. Custom solutions can be produced.
